LITTLEJOHN, Justice:

This wrongful death action arose out of the death by drowning of three-year-old Christopher Legette in a septic tank. Plaintiff, the deceased's father brought suit as the administrator of his son's estate, alleging the negligence of the defendant in constructing and installing the septic tank as the sole and proximate cause of his son's death.
